A description is given of a method for casting molten metals, in particular magnesium, with a low-pressure casting device (1). The low-pressure casting device (1) has a casting mould (2), a heatable crucible (3) for holding a metal melt (4) to be cast, a metering vessel (7) arranged in the crucible (3), a riser (11), starting from the metering vessel (7), preferably extending vertically upwards, and having a mouthpiece for connection to a gate (12) of the casting mould (2); a heating jacket (13) surrounding the riser (11) and a pressure line (14) connected to the metering vessel (7). To pump the molten metal into the casting mould (2), a pressurised gas is introduced into the metering vessel (7) via the pressure line (14). According to the invention, relatively great compaction of the metal and largely void-free castings of high mechanical strength are obtained by the fact that the molten metal is pumped at a delivery pressure of 0.5 to 6.0 bar, preferably 0.6 to 2.0 bar, in particular 0.6 to 1.2 bar. <IMAGE>
